Description

Sir R. Rowand Anderson 1879-81. Early pointed, red rubble

with yellow sandstone dressings, orientated N-S with

unfinished S.W. tower (intended for broach spire). 90' 5-bay

nave with 4-bay W. aisle brick lined; 43' chancel with W.

organ chamber brick-lined banded with marble, 3 seat sedilia,

good furnishings, panelling and redecoration of roof Sir

Matthew Ochterlony late 1940s.
